FAQs about Best Western Premier Suites Hotel & Spa Liverpool-Knowsley

Is parking available at the hotel?

Free self-parking is available on-site, with limited spaces.


What type of breakfast is offered and what are the serving hours?

Cooked-to-order breakfasts are served on weekdays from 7:00 AM to 9:30 AM and on weekends from 8:00 AM to 10:30 AM for a fee of approximately GBP 12.00 for adults and GBP 5.00 for children.


What are the check-in and check-out times?

Check-in is from 3:00 PM until 11:59 PM, and check-out is by 11:00 AM. Early check-in and late check-out are available for a fee of GBP 20.00, subject to availability.


What accessibility features are available for guests with disabilities?

The property offers limited wheelchair accessibility, including step-free entrances and wheelchair-accessible facilities in public areas.

What is the location of the hotel in relation to nearby attractions?

The hotel is located in Liverpool (Knowsley), within a 15-minute drive of Anfield Stadium and Knowsley Safari Park. It is approximately 8 miles from Royal Albert Dock and 7.6 miles from Liverpool ONE.


Does the hotel have a swimming pool?

Yes, the hotel features an indoor swimming pool. However, the pool may be closed on certain days, including Wednesday through Sunday.


Are children allowed to stay at the hotel?

Children are welcome at the property, and kids can stay for free up to a certain age, although the specific age limit is not provided.


What are the policies regarding extra beds and cribs?

The hotel offers rollaway beds for a fee of GBP 10.00 per night, subject to availability. Advance request or confirmation may be required.
